CFBXA took the skies on Good Friday to help add important currency certifications for Dallen (Nav) and Ted (Spotter). Target(s) was successfully found. Thanks to Howard and Peter for the target placement.

CGVBA, Pilot Wolfgang, was again called into training action for two flights totaling 3.1 hrs of flight time. Why? Both Navs, Howard & Martin, required specific flight patterns to maintain their "currency". Wolfgang added to his necessary Pilot hours. Our [...]
Island CASRA units were actively involved in the Military SAREX over the period Feb 26 - Mar 01. Some 16 flights were planned with 7 being allocated to CASARA Nanaimo. Our fearless leader, Jim, was the Search Co-ordinator/Manager for [...]
A break in the weather allowed 2 training flights using two aircraft; CFBXA & CGVBA. GVBA is owned by Nanaimo flying Club and was piloted by Wolfgang - his first official flight as a CASARA Pilot. Congratulations Wolfgang. The Exercise [...]
CASARA Nanaimo were active participants in this multi-day exercise, both in the air and on the land. Originally scheduled to undertake 7 flights over three days we managed to successfully complete 3 flights. The others being cancelled because of [...]
